Baking Tips for Success
To ensure your Capricorn Pistachio Rose Cake turns out perfectly, make sure all your ingredients are at room temperature before you begin. This helps them blend more easily, resulting in a smoother batter. Additionally, be mindful not to overmix the batter; mixing just until combined will help maintain the cake's light texture.
While baking, keep an eye on the cake as oven temperatures can vary. A toothpick inserted into the center should come out clean when it's done. Once baked, allow it to cool completely before frosting to prevent the icing from melting. These simple tips will help you achieve a cake that’s not only delicious but also visually stunning.
Ingredients
Gather all the ingredients before you start for a smooth baking experience.
Cake Ingredients
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up ground pistachios
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up buttermilk
- 1 tablespoon rosewater
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Frosting Ingredients
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1/2 cup powdered sugar
- 1 teaspoon rosewater
- Chopped pistachios for garnish
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ature for best results.
Instructions
Follow these steps carefully to create a stunning cake.
Prepare the Cake Batter
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a bowl, whisk together the flour, ground pistachios,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
In a separate large bowl, cream the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. Mix in the buttermilk, rosewater, and vanilla extract.
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
Bake the Cake
Pour the batter into a greased cake pan and smooth the top. Bake for 25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. Allow to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
Make the Frosting
In a mixing bowl, whip the heavy cream until it begins to thicken. Gradually add the powdered sugar and rosewater, continuing to whip until stiff peaks form.
Assemble the Cake
Once the cake is completely cool, spread the frosting generously on top. Garnish with chopped pistachios.

Storage and Preservation
To keep your Capricorn Pistachio Rose Cake fresh, store it in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days. If you want to preserve it for a longer period, consider refrigerating it, but make sure to allow it to come to room temperature before serving for the best flavor experience.
If you have leftovers, you can freeze the cake. W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and then foil to prevent freezer burn. It can be stored in the freezer for up to three months. When you're ready to enjoy it again, simply thaw it overnight in the refrigerator before serving!
Questions About Recipes
→ Can I substitute ground pistachios with another nut?
Yes, you can use ground almonds or walnuts if you prefer.
→ Is rosewater necessary for this recipe?
Rosewater adds unique flavor, but you can omit it if you don't have it on hand.
→ How should I store the cake?
Store the cake in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
→ Can I make this cake ahead of time?
Absolutely! You can bake the cake a day in advance and frost it just before serving.
